Royal Canadian Mint - Designed by Canadian artist Glen Loates, your coin portrays a scimitar sabre-tooth cat in standing atop a rocky outcrop in a vast grassland. The image, reviewed for scientific accuracy by paleontologists of the Royal Tyrrell Museum of Paleontology, presents a full-body portrait of the Ice Age predator, with its fierce teeth on display as it opens its mouth. A frosted "ice"-like dome overlays the portrait. The portion of the portrait under the ice is coloured, while the remainder of the image is struck-only, giving the impression of a colourful window to our land's ancient past. The reverse includes the text "CANADA" and the date "2018." The obverse features the effigy of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II by Susanna Blunt, as well as the coin value of "20 DOLLARS."
